The Rogers Centre, home to the Toronto Blue Jays

The suites at this stunning park have all the standard amenities: comfy stuffed chairs, retractable glass panels, outside seating, indoor dining, a bar, bathroom, flat-screen TVs and walls decorated with sports memorabilia. "The big revolution when that ballpark opened," says sports author Josh Leventhal, "was the sheer number of luxury boxes." There are 150 available and they go for about $32,000 a game. Luxury box guests also have access to the new, exclusive members-only Club 200 VIP, which features a lavish lounge area and dining tables at the edge of the action.
